Translation of General Correspondence
General correspondence translation encompasses a wide range of documents, including business communications, conference invitations, official letters, sponsorship requests, and more. While the format tends to be relatively flexible, it is essential to use language and tone that reflect the recipient’s cultural background and specific context.
Effective translation of correspondence requires careful consideration of the letter’s purpose, the recipient’s perspective, and the intended message. The language should be natural and contextually appropriate, ranging from informal personal exchanges to formal business letters. Each type of correspondence should be translated with a tailored approach to suit its unique character and intent.
